Preserving the Heart of Sanger: A Historical Reflection with Tona Batis and the Sanger Area Historical Society
Embark on a historical adventure as we sit down with Tona Batis, the dedicated president of the Sanger Area Historical Society, and uncover the evolution of Sanger, Texas. Our guest brings the past to life, revealing how the Sanger brothers and the Gulf, Colorado, and Santa Fe Railroad were instrumental in transforming the town from a humble cattle stop into a thriving hub of activity.
